Output 660228e461aed9bb7a626a5d940b8fac8477dc49618603445f971004d27a4eb1:1

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376c16d4d88079b4828ce2a8927ec652e77ed OP_EQUAL
address
3BMEXrTULE9b8fQMmCu4aD6L4MMP27MmB7
transaction
660228e461aed9bb7a626a5d940b8fac8477dc49618603445f971004d27a4eb1
spent
true